  11. Gotta agree the electric collar is the best option. But zapping the dog AS it attacks the sheep may cause more problems depending on how strong the dog is (mentally), the dog may think the pain is caused by the sheep and go up a gear. I would use the collar on the recall around livestock(without other dogs present), but as people have said who will be happy having a stock killer trained around there livestock.

  22. Ideally it should be 60% raw meaty bones and 40% meat. Mine get 60% chicken wings and 40% minced meat, this varies and is usually minced beef, beef and tripe, lamb or lamb and veg. My dogs have been on this for about 5-6 years and it was the best move i made, the dogs look better and they prefer it. Send me a pm if you need a supplier who delivers
